The drama tells about the first criminal profiler in South Korea who can read the minds of serial killers. Through the Darkness (악의 마음을 읽는 자들) is a South Korean television series starring Kim Nam-gil, Jin Seon-kyu and Kim So-jin. Based on non fiction novel "Akui Maeumeul Ilneun Jadeul" by profiler Kwon Il-Yong & writer Go Na-Moo (published September 28, 2018 by Alma). Profiler Kwon Il Yong became a police officer in 1989 and the first criminal profiler in Korea in 2000.
